On 2019-03-06 17:57, James Darnley wrote:
> What's the best documentation to read to understand how to use cygport
> to build packages?

/usr/share/doc/cygport/html/manual/index.html

> I am trying to use it to build Lua 5.3 and some modules.  I think I
> bashed the Lua 5.2 cygport file into the right shape to build 5.3
> correctly.  But I don't know how to use the result of that to build
> other modules that depend on it.
> I need to give gcc and ld the right flags.  Do I use package config for
> that?  Do I statically define the right flags?  Can I import variables
> from the 5.3 cygport file into other cygport files?  It doesn't like
> "inherit lua53" at the top so I don't know what to do now.

/usr/share/doc/cygport/html/manual/lua_cygclass.html
